I work in the construction industry. Trust me, you can drive vans on a lot of terrible roads. You can also get vans with 4wd.
Some people in this industry prefer vans over pickups because the space inside a van is more practical. Personally I drive a van just because that's what the boss set up for us. But occationally we use a pickup to haul heavy things.
I think both vans and pickup trucks have their place in serious work.
Vans are god tier when it comes to organizing your tools, or transporting things in general. With a pretty big van, you can even eliminate the need for a trailer in many cases. I put so much junk into my van, with a pickup I ironically couldn't pick up as much shit as I do in my van.

Let's first clear up one thing:
>2016 Mazda CX-5 UK Towing Rating: 1800kg
>2016 Mazda CX-5 Canada Towing Rating: 907kg
>Same engine
So considering that whatever standards UK tests to for towing are VASTLY different, by a factor of 2 (though for the comparison below, let's say 1.5), let's compare the average fleet vehicle:
>Isuzu D-Max Ext. Cab 2WD: $30'500CAD (converted from BPD to CAD)
>1085 / 3500kg payload/braked trailer capacity, so closer to 725 / 2333kg adjusted to NA standards
>157hp 295ftlb 2.5L 4cyl
>5.5ft bed
>Ford F-150 Ext. Cab 2WD: $26,859CAD
>754 / 2272kg payload/braked trailer capacity
>365hp 420ftlb 3.5L V6
>6.5ft bed
Dodge RAM 1500 Quad Cab 2WD: $33,490CAD
>727 / 4200kg payload/braked trailer capacity
>240hp 420ftlb 3.0L V6
>6.5ft bed
North America just does trucks better for basically the same price or less.
